We’ve been following the realization of the television adaptation of the Powers comic by Brian Michael Bendis and Michael Avon Oeming. Last year a pilot has already been shot for FX. Today we’re reporting that Sony Pictures Television has not only moved the series but will be scrapping the previous cast and pilot.

PlayStation, joining the likes of Netflix (Hemlock Grove), Amazon (The After) and Xbox (Halo, in development), is taking on Powers as its first attempt at playing host to a television series, and will most likely get a 10 episode order, this according to THR.

After cleaning house, Charlie Huston is on board to write. Bendis and Oeming will  be producing, and Michael Dinner (producer on Justified) remains as executive producer and director.

Powers follows detective Christian Walker who protects humans from people with supernatural abilities. So it’s the best of superheroes and police procedural combined. Just the kind of show we’d love.
